#2ebdd6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2ebdd6 is composed of 18% red, 74.1% green and 83.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.5% cyan, 11.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 188.9 degrees, a saturation of 67.2% and a lightness of 51%. #2ebdd6 color hex could be obtained by blending #5cffff with #007bad.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#2ebdd6 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#2ebdd6 has RGB values of R:46, G:189, B:214 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0.12,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 3063254.

Hex triplet 2ebdd6 #2ebdd6
RGB Decimal 46, 189, 214 rgb(46,189,214)
RGB Percent 18, 74.1, 83.9 rgb(18%,74.1%,83.9%)
CMYK 79, 12, 0, 16
HSL 188.9°, 67.2, 51 hsl(188.9,67.2%,51%)
HSV (or HSB) 188.9°, 78.5, 83.9
Web Safe 33cccc #33cccc
CIE-LAB 70.752, -28.07, -23.066
XYZ 31.458, 41.828, 70.03
xyY 0.22, 0.292, 41.828
CIE-LCH 70.752, 36.331, 219.411
CIE-LUV 70.752, -48.778, -32.302
Hunter-Lab 64.675, -26.356, -18.927
Binary 00101110, 10111101, 11010110

Shades and Tints of #2ebdd6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010404 is the darkest color, while #f3fb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#2ebdd6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b8789 is the less saturated color, while #08d8fc is the most saturated one.
